6 = ln (x + 4)
For this case, the first thing to do is to use the exponential for both sides of the equation.
We have then:
exp (6) = exp (ln (x + 4))
Rewriting we have:
exp (6) = x + 4
Clearing x:
x = exp (6) - 4
Calculated:
x = 399.4287935
nearest hundreth:
x = 399.43
Answer:
The value of x is:
x = 399.43
